In this paper,we study network formation games.The main research is one-way flow and two-way flow network formation game.By understanding the approach of formation and the properties about these two classes of networks,a systematic study on the existence of Nash networks and the characteristics of networks is done for varieties of network formation games,with a situation of non-cooperation and incomplete cooperation.The basic knowledge and concept of one-way flow network formation game is introduced in Chapter 1,including homogeneous costs,heterogeneous costs and the properties of one-way flow networks under situation with decay.Under the situation of no-decay,we prove existence of Nash networks with homogeneous costs.Meanwhile, through a counterexample we illustrate that Nash networks do not always exist when costs are heterogeneous.Under the situation of decay,by defining the level of decay,the payoff function is given.Furthermore,we illustrate the condition that how a network become a strict Nash network.In Chapter 2,we consider one-way flow network formation game with fixed coalition partition by defining coalition-homogeneous costs.This class of network differs from the situation of homogeneous costs and heterogeneous costs.Also,we need note that the way about the network formation is dynamic.The network is formed by agents playing local movement,i.e.an agent can add,delete or replace only one link each time.The rule of the movement is maximizing the payoff of the whole coalition containing him first.Under this new rule,we will provide the architecture and existence theorem of the local Nash network. B&G function is chosen as the payoff function of the agents,by which B&G function on coalition-agent is generated.Finally,we allocate the payoff within the coalition according to Myerson value.We mainly study the properties of two-way flow network in Chapter 3.Differing from one-way flow networks,the links formed by an agent in the network are asymmetrical,i.e. when a pair of agents in the network form a link,both of them can obtain benefits,but the initiator need afford the costs.At the same time,we study the properties of two-way flow networks with decay and no-decay.
